What Is the Cost of Living Near Peoria?

Understanding the cost of living near Peoria is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Carpenter's Local Union 237.
Peoria's Cost of Living Index is approximately 78.2 (21.8% less expensive than US average; 16.6% less than IL average). Central IL city, very affordable housing. CityLink. When planning your budget based on a salary from Carpenter's Local Union 237,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$750 - $1,150+ A significant portion of Carpenter's Local Union 237 sal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(CityLink mon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$360 - $540 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$300 - $580+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$350 - $650+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,960 - $3,170+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
